About Atlantic Broadband Bill Pay:
Atlantic Broadband is considered to the eighth largest cable operator within the United States. They offer phone, TV, and internet services throughout the United States. There are over 307,000 television service consumers within the 11 states. In 2004, Atlantic Broadband was first started as the Spin-off of Charter Communications. The headquarter of this company is located in Quincy, Massachusetts, United States. Then in 2012, Atlantic Broadband was acquired by Cogeco. This company also purchased the MetroCast in 2018 and merged it with the Atlantic Broadband.

Pay Atlantic Broadband Bill by Telephone:
Atlantic Broadband also allows the customers to pay their bills over the telephone. To make the payment over the phone, you need to call at 888-536-9600. After calling on this number, you have to follow the on-call instructions. While calling, keep your account number and financial details ready. You can use your debit card or credit card to make the payment.
Pay Atlantic Broadband Bill by Mail:
You can also make the payment for the Atlantic Broadband via the traditional mail method. Simply return your payment stub in the bill that you receive every month from the Atlantic Broadband. You can send a personal check or money order to complete your payment. But, make sure to include the account number on the personal check or money order. Also, check that you have enough time to pay your bill. Because payment over mail takes time to process.
How the Penalty Fees Work:
There are several fees, that you have to pay if you break the terms and conditions. You will be charged the late payment fees if you can’t make the payment by the due date. There are also the returned payment fees if your check is back for insufficient balance. Other than these, there are reconnection fees, collection fees, equipment fees, etc.
